World Brush logo World Brush

AR app where you paint on the real world for others to find

SimpleCipherText logo SimpleCipherText

SimpleCipherText is a simple to use text editor with the additional functionality of cyphering the text.

World Brush features and specs

  • User-Generated Content
    World Brush allows users to create and share augmented reality art that overlays the real world, fostering creativity and collaboration among a global audience.
  • Augmented Reality Experience
    The application provides an engaging AR experience, allowing users to view, interact with, and contribute art in real-world locations using their mobile devices.
  • Community Engagement
    World Brush encourages community engagement by enabling users to discover and interact with AR creations made by others, boosting social connectivity.
  • Global Accessibility
    The platform is accessible globally, allowing users from different parts of the world to experience and contribute to a shared digital canvas.

Possible disadvantages of World Brush

  • Limited Platform Availability
    World Brush may not be available on all devices or platforms, limiting access for some users depending on their hardware and software.
  • Content Moderation Challenges
    With the user-generated nature of the content, managing inappropriate or malicious contributions could be a challenge, requiring robust moderation systems.
  • Privacy Concerns
    As the app uses location-based services to augment reality with digital art, there might be concerns regarding user privacy and data security.
  • Battery and Data Usage
    The augmented reality features may lead to higher battery consumption and data usage on mobile devices, which could be a drawback for some users.

SimpleCipherText features and specs

  • Simple and lightweight
    SimpleCipherText is a small, lightweight application that doesn't require significant system resources, making it easy to run on virtually any Windows machine without performance concerns.
  • Easy to use
    The program features a straightforward and minimalistic interface that allows users to quickly encrypt and decrypt text without needing technical expertise or a steep learning curve.
  • Free to use
    SimpleCipherText is available as a free tool, making it accessible to anyone who needs basic text encryption without having to pay for expensive software.
  • Portable option
    The application is small enough to be carried on a USB drive or portable storage, allowing users to encrypt and decrypt text on the go without needing to install software on every computer.
  • Quick text encryption
    Users can rapidly encrypt or decrypt text with just a few clicks, making it convenient for quick, on-the-fly text obfuscation tasks.

Possible disadvantages of SimpleCipherText

  • Basic encryption capabilities
    SimpleCipherText likely uses simple cipher methods rather than industry-standard encryption algorithms, meaning it may not provide strong security for sensitive or critical data.
  • Limited features
    The application is very basic and lacks advanced features found in more robust encryption tools, such as file encryption, multiple algorithm support, or batch processing.
  • No active development
    The software appears to be an older or niche project that may not receive regular updates, bug fixes, or security patches, potentially leaving vulnerabilities unaddressed.
  • Limited documentation and support
    As a small, free utility, SimpleCipherText likely has minimal documentation, no dedicated support team, and a small user community, making troubleshooting difficult.
  • Windows only
    The tool is designed for Windows and is not available on other operating systems such as macOS or Linux, limiting its usability for users on different platforms.
